HOHWALD
Nature on a platter
The rich meadows, surrounded of fir trees and majestic beeches,
characterize the site of Hohwald, which is unique in Alsace.
The
beauty of the panoramas
Sheltered from the wind, the charming station of holiday profits
from an exceptional sunning, in summer as well as winter.
The purity of the air disputes it with the beauty of the panoramas.
From this privileged site, you will discover the Sainte-Odile
Mount with its pagan wall, the Field of Fire and the Road
of the crests, the castles of High-Andlau and Spesbourg, or
also Andlau and Barr, major stages of the Wine trail of Alsace.
A station
full with charms
Hohwald has at all times be a unique place equipped with a
heart. Formerly populated with stockbreeders from Switzerland
and from Austria, it city-dwellers in love of nature and calmness
very early. Thus, Sarah Bernhardt, the Joffre marshal, Emile
Mathis the Adenauer chancellor
elect residence in luxurious villas there. Houses which, with
the many hotels and pensions, contribute to the charm of the

In summer
as in winter
Varied activities are proposed throughout the year, in order
to support relaxation and discovery of the country: Pedestrian
excursions and circuits of great excursion - 120 km of marked
out routes - climbing with the Rock of Neuntelstein (4 km),
bicycle of mountain, foot bath, school of paragliding at Breitenbachn,
Parc Alsace adVentures with the Collar of Kreuzweg. 
From
650 to 1100 m of altitude
Ski touring and skiing on track are practised on the spot
and in a radius of 10 km, between 650 and 1100 m of altitude.
